580. To ask the Minister for Rural and Community Development if his attention has been drawn to the fact that a group (details supplied) has been excluded from availing of the grant from the men's sheds fund; the reason for this exclusion;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[25059/19]

Photo of Michael RingMichael Ring (Mayo, Fine Gael)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source

In 2019, my Department is providing funding of €4.5m for community groups through its Community Enhancement Programme (CEP). An additional €0.5m has been ring-fenced under the Programme for provision to Men's (and Women's) Sheds. This funding provides small grants to enable sheds to purchase equipment or to carry out minor works to their premises .

To quality for this ring-fenced fund, sheds must be affiliated to the Irish Men's Sheds Association. All other groups, including the group referenced in the question, were eligible to apply for funding under the main CEP, under which €4.5m is available in 2019.

I note that in 2018, the group in question was approved for €1,000 under the main CEP, and LEADER funding of €3,696, also provided by my Department.
